Summary:
- To assist certified professional staff with students in all education environments to meet instructional goals and objectives.
Qualifications:
- Hold a Paraprofessional License.
- Present evidence of a physical exam to determine "fit for duty", evidence of being free from communicable disease (TB), and submit to a criminal background check.
- Participation in de-escalation technique training and any additional training as required by the district.
- Ability to understand, apply, and use computers and software applications.
- Ability to communicate effectively in written or verbal forms.
- Ability to travel between schools, or between schools and district office.
- Ability to work outdoors during outdoor student activities.
Physical Demands:
- Regularly required to bend, reach with hands and arms, sit on a chair, sit on the ground with students, kneel, crouch, stand, crawl, walk, and navigate stairs.
- Be capable of physically assisting students as required (positioning, lifting, transferring, etc.).
- Specific vision abilities required include close vision, peripheral vision, depth perception, and the ability to adjust focus.
- Ability to verbally communicate and the ability to hear effectively.
- Occasionally lift and/or move up to 30 pounds.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
- Assists students in all aspects of classroom instruction to maximize learning, achievement, and inclusion.
- Assists and guides students to reinforce reading, language arts, mathematics, and other skills.
- Works with students individually, in small groups, or whole groups to reinforce and re-teach learning.
- Assists professional staff in the administration and correction of classroom activities and assessments.
- Assists with record-keeping procedures.
- Assists with classroom management to minimize disruptions, ensure a safe and orderly classroom, and ensure students are on task.
- Assists all students in non-instructional areas, such as supervising the student lunch program, bus duty, playground duty, hallway supervision, study hall, and other related non-instructional areas.
- Prepares education materials as needed.
- Assists students with activities such as daily living for the purpose of maximizing their ability to participate in school or learning activities (toileting, feeding, maneuvering, hygiene, etc).
- Ability to maintain confidentiality of information regarding students, employees, and others.
- Assists with fostering independence, socialization, and self-esteem for all students.
- Substitute for paraprofessionals or, when certified, for teachers, ensuring continuity of instruction and student support.
- Perform any other related duties, as assigned, for the purpose of ensuring the efficient and effective functioning of the school.
